Quality Control
Position Summary
Implementation and support of quality control efforts to ensure that requirements for processing conform to quality standards. Maintain quality assurance standards, procedures, and controls.
Principal Duties and Responsibilities
- Conduct routine sampling and inspection of ingredients, finished products and packaging.
- Assist Quality & Food Safety Manager with the initiation and follow-up of corrective and interim action plans related to non-compliance issues.
- Segregate and hold non-compliance finished products and ingredients according to Julio’s procedures.
- Ensures compliance with Good Manufacturing Practices, and Food Safety ProgramsFollow critical control point procedures per our HACCP Program Pre-Op documentation (ATP swab test)
- Calibrate laboratory equipment (pH meter, thermometers) as needed. Daily Scale Calibration check
- Conducts metal detector and nitrogen gas checks. Conduct operational sanitation checks (ATP swab test)
- Ensure products are made according to finished product specification forms.
- Performs routine net weight checks.
- Notify management immediately whenever any food safety and/or quality risk is observed.
